VBA lernen - Excel 2007/2010 (2)

Von: Dieter Frommhold
Stand: 16. Januar 2011
Anmelden um Kommentare zu schreiben

Einige Steueranweisungen

Ein einfaches Beispiel mit Entscheidungen und Zyklus

Öffnen Sie die Arbeitsmappe Lösung Variable und Steuerelemente.xlsm. Im Tabellenblatt Tabelle1 finden Sie eine einfache Rechenaufgabe. Ein Klick auf den Button EinmalEins präsentiert die Lösung.

Beispiel für Entscheidung und Zyklen

Option Explicit
Dim Eingabewert As Variant 'Lässt auch Texteingabe zu 
Dim Ganz As Integer
Dim I As Byte

Sub einmaleins()
Eingabewert = InputBox("Bitte eine ganze Zahl zwischen 1 und 20", "Eingabe")
If Eingabewert < 1 Or Eingabewert > 20 Then
MsgBox "eingegebene Zahl " & Eingabewert & " ist falsch!"
Exit Sub
End If
Ganz = Eingabewert
Worksheets("Tabelle1").Range("E3").Value = Ganz
For I = 1 To 20
Worksheets("Tabelle1").Cells(4 + I, 4).Value = Ganz
Worksheets("Tabelle1").Cells(4 + I, 6).Value = I * Ganz
Next
End Sub

Die im Beispielcode verwendeten Steueranweisungen If-Then-Entscheidung, Zyklus For - Next und neue Methoden und Eigenschaften werden nachfolgend erläutert.

Diese Seite ist für Mitglieder von akademie.de reserviert.

Möchten Sie die Mitgliedschaft 14 Tage kostenlos testen und den Beitrag komplett lesen?

Oder möchten Sie zunächst mehr über diesen Beitrag erfahren und die Leseproben sehen?

Ich bin bereits Mitglied
Jetzt Probemitglied werden
Ich kann in den 14 Tagen Probezeit formlos z.B. per E-Mail stornieren. Wenn ich das nicht tue, entscheide ich mich für ein